Recap Roundups
January 13, 2018
Duke 89, Wake Forest 71
Marvin Bagley III scored 30 points and pulled in 11 rebounds as seventh-ranked Duke drilled Wake Forest 89-71 without coach Mike Krzyzewski on the bench Saturday afternoon at Cameron Indoor Stadium in Durham, N.C.

Michigan 82, Michigan St 72
Moritz Wagner poured in a career-high 27 points, and Michigan upset error-prone No. 4 Michigan State on the road 82-72 on Saturday afternoon at Breslin Center in East Lansing, Mich.

Purdue 81, Minnesota 47
Senior forward Vincent Edwards matched his career best of five 3-pointers and scored a season-high 25 points as No. 5 Purdue rolled to an 81-47 victory over Minnesota on Saturday in Big Ten play at Williams Arena in Minneapolis.

Seton Hall 74, Georgetown 61
Guards Desi Rodriguez and Myles Powell scored 19 points apiece as No. 13 Seton Hall took control late in the first half and posted a 74-61 victory over Georgetown on Saturday afternoon at the Prudential Center in Newark, N.J.

Kansas 73, Kansas State 72
Sophomore guard Malik Newman made two free throws with 15.2 seconds remaining Saturday and senior guard Devonte' Graham netted a game-high 23 points as No. 12 Kansas nipped Kansas State 73-72 at Lawrence, Kan.
